The Rebel Romanov: Julie of Saxe-Coburg, the Empress Russia Never Had
Book • 2025
This book tells the story of Julie of Saxe-Coburg, who was selected by Catherine the Great as a bride for her grandson Constantine.
Julie found herself in a Russian court dominated by rumors and rivalries, married to a volatile and abusive husband.
Despite the challenges, she sought freedom and eventually left the court with the permission of Tsar Alexander.
The book explores her life, including her illegitimate children and her struggles, which have largely been forgotten by history.
Rappaport's extensive research brings Julie's story to life, highlighting her as a bold woman ahead of her time who sacrificed her reputation and luxury for personal freedom.
